Biographical/historical information
Rev. Norman was a graduate of Concord High School and the University of North Carolina. He taught school in Concord and then entered the seminary from which he graduated in 1917. Rev. Norman served as a missionary to Japan from 1917 to 1931.
Scope and arrangement
This interview recounts his experiences as a youth and as a missionary.
